I really should be using one of my rubber/clear stamps as I have many BUT I have a very good reason for sharing a digi. Our Grandson was two on Tuesday and try as I might I could not find a rubber stamp featuring a digger anywhere!! The beauty of digis is that they can be resized, flipped, they are cost effective and you can hide them from your Significant Other!!
We bought Jackson a little Joey JCB and I wanted to make him a card to match so trawling Etsy I found this digital set of cute Construction digitals from Little Pearly Studio. They are really charming and really easy to fussy cut too. The papers are also digital from here and I used Word to add the personalised sentiment.
